function HomeFeatureManager() {
	var preloadList = "";
	var currBkg = 0;
	var imgArray = [];
	var self = this;
	
	for(var i=0; i<imgArray.length; i++) {
			preloadList += "'" + imgArray[i].bkg + "'";
			if(i != (imgArray.length-1)) {
				preloadList += ",";
			}
		}
		
	$.preLoadImages(preloadList);
	
	this.addFeature = function(params) {
		params.desc = params.desc.toUpperCase();
		imgArray.push(params);
	}
	
	this.change = function(direction) {
		if(direction == 'next') {
			if( (currBkg + 1) <= (imgArray.length - 1) ) {
				currBkg++;
			} else {
				currBkg = 0;
			}
		} else {
			if( currBkg > 0) {
				currBkg--;
			} else {
				currBkg = imgArray.length - 1;
			}
		}
		self.showFeature();
	}
	
	this.showFeature = function() {
		$("#mainBkgImg").attr("src", imgArray[currBkg].bkg);
		$("#featureDesc").html(imgArray[currBkg].desc);
	}
	
}


